grow wild in this area. One particular evening in August we set
off by car from Maison Calme to visit a village called Angles-sur-l'Anglin.
I had read somewhere about this village in a French magazine and
was taken back by the photographs of the castle perched high on
the cliffs of rock. Little did we think that forty minutes from
maison calme we would be there, and just what I had seen in the
magazine would now be a reality. A beautiful castle perched on what
seemed to be a mix of granite and tuffeau stone after exploration
of the outside of the castle and small church. We returned to our
car and drove down the narrow streets to the bridge over the river
and driving back we were greeted with the gastronomic delights of
people eating and drinking in small restaurants and bars. A fine
way to spend an evening. Not surprising that Angles-sur-l'Anglin
is said to be Frances most beautiful village.

RICHELIEU
Lovely
small town lots of interest. Very good steam railway which in season
runs to Chinnon. Great for the kids.

LOCHES
Large
town, part old and part new. Nice shops, Very interesting castle
which is reputed to house the deepest dungeon in France. Take the
kids? Loches
also has some fine antique shops.
DESCARTES
Medium
sized town with small supermarket, banks, restaurants and nice bars.
You can also find a boulangerie et patisserie specializing in cakes
and bread Descartoise style. Descartes also has a fine museum, parc
de loisirs and a very good produce market on Sundays, yes really
red sweet tomatoes!!. DESCARTES IS THE BIRTHPLACE OF THE FAMOUS
PHILOSOPHER RE'NE DESCARTES
